This is a home style, comfort food, small restaurant in the town of Scheneves named after an Indian chief .The front and back of the menu display information about the Indian chief , his daughter and legends of their life . Everything is homemade,many dishes cooked to order . Pastries, pies, cakes, breads are attractively displayed. The menu is not fancy and features homemade soups, chili, salads, breakfast and lunch dishes, burgers, wraps, sandwiches, etc. I opted for the chili and was told it was mild and if I prefer more heat the chef would add more spice to the recipe when served. I enjoyed my chili ,topped it with onions and cheese which cost a bit extra with sour cream on the side . It was most delicious . My dining made ordered the California Reuben a sandwich of turkey swiss cheese , sauerkraut on Kimmel rye He said it was very tasty. His came with a side, many choices but he ordered the potatoe salad which was very creamy and tasty. Portions were good, food plated nicely. Hot food came out hot . Prices very reasonable. The restaurant was filled with customers, and was clean and neat. The restaurant is closed mid December to mid March and normally closed on Tuesdays. We think a great little find on our way to Albany.
